DIY: Missoni Shoes

Missoni sneakers are a cute way to spice up an outfit, and they’re simple and cheap to make. Most of the items you need are lying around the house except for a pair of white canvas sneakers, which can be found super cheap at almost any shoe or clothing store. Check out this guide, taken from Refinery29, that tells you how to make your own Missoni shoes.

 

Materials:

  • White canvas sneakers
  • Ruler
  • Manila folder or some other stiff paper
  • Pencil
  • Scissors
  • Fabric markers in whatever colors you want. Markers with thick and thin tips are best.

 

1. Make a straight line near the edge of the folder.

 

2. Make a second line about half an inch down from the first line. Once done, make tick marks a half an inch apart on both lines.

 

3. Create the zig-zag pattern by connecting every other dot on the lines.

 

4. Cut on the line, so that when you’re done the manila folder will look like it has a set of teeth.

 

5. Take the laces out of the sneakers.

 

6. Put the template you just made near the toe of the sneaker. Line it up however you like. Lightly trace the template, so that later when you go over it with marker it will be hidden.

 

7. Keep repeating, moving the template back, until the whole sneaker has been covered. Try to line up the triangles as best as you can, but don’t worry about the spacing between the lines. It’s good to have some big spaces and some small spaces.

8. Color in the rows, each one a different color. Because the markers may bleed, try coloring in every other line, and after a few minutes to let it dry, go back and color in the white spaces. If you have it, use the thick marker tip to trace the line, and the thin marker tip to color in the space.

 

9. To make it seem more professional and polished, don’t forget to color the inside rim of the sneaker as well.

 

10. Check all the nooks and crannies of the sneakers, such as the seams, to make sure there are no white spots where there shouldn’t be.

 

11. Lace up and go! After you repeat on the second sneaker, you now have an edgy pair of sneakers ready for any occasion.
